Newborn infant found abandoned in South Delhi

A baby born about five hours earlier was found abandoned in Pushp Vihar area of south Delhi on Tuesday night. The baby was discovered by three children at around 9 pm under a cooler in house number 1857 Sector 3 in Pushp Vihar.

Three kids - Vivek, Rajesh and Rohit - found the infant wrapped in a shirt under a cooler which belongs to a person identified as Omesh Kumar Chauhan. After responding to the queries of the trio, Chauhan made a PCR call and around 10 pm. Police reached the spot accompanied by an ambulance that did spot check-up of the baby.

"We were playing in the park and suddenly we heard the wails of a baby. Tracking the sound we found the infant under a cooler; there was no blood. Without wasting any moment we informed Chauhan uncle," said Vivek.u00a0

Soon after the check-up of the newborn had been conducted by doctors, police took charge of it and proceeded towards AIIMS to keep the infant under proper care.
